Well after enjoying my venom 3 for a bit, I bought a diamond back platinum for my RSA Dmitri. I have to say I'm pretty disappointed. It has almost no bass compared to the stock cord, The opening of DSOTM on Vinyl with the stock chord shakes the floor during the opening of the album, the diamondback no more deep bass. The midrange and treble seem very restrained and altered as well. The stage is bigger and more diffuse, but the music is less involving. I was looking for just good clean power, not a tone control. I plugged some household items into the conditioner and ran it for a few days, no real change in the cable. I am returning it to Music direct and will try the new Zitron VIper. Hoping I will be more impressed. Any thoughts.

I recently replaced a Venom 3 and a DB Platinum, the DB Platinum was on my cdp and the Venom 3 was on my preamp. Of the two in MY system it seemed they were similar with the DB being cleaner from mid to top with a slightly lower noise. I am now happily using the Sidewinder VTX for my pre and cdp and am very curious about trying the new Vipers. If anyone tries them let us know.

The Hydra HC is made to power a power conditioner. It has the same gauge as the Zitron Python 9 gauge.
IF you are powering a powercondititioner and don't want to splash out on a Zitron Python but still want the juice it provides then Hydra HC is for you. Last edited by Crion; 01-09-2013 at 11:22 AM. |
